Provided by YP.comI first went to Posh because my normal salon had botched some highlights and were not willing to work with me on getting me back in to fix the problem. Posh had an opening that evening with Jennifer. It. Was. Amazing. Jennifer is a master stylist so she charges quite a bit, but I believe that you get what you pay for and she is worth every penny. There are other stylists in all levels of the field, so you would be able to find someone that doesn't charge as much if that's an issue. The staff is friendly (from my experiences, even when I was running 5 minutes behind schedule), and the salon is very open, but inviting. All of the staff seems to get along and I think that sets a good environment for customers to enter into, instead of a place where no one gets along and they're being catty. They do like to "strongly recommend" products to purchase, but they don't get defensive and weird when you don't want to spend another $75 on shampoo. Even though I regularly go to Jennifer, I would feel comfortable having anyone else in that salon cut my hair.
